Without any further ado, here's the rundown of the pre-July 1st signings from the past 24 hours.
- Buffalo will be Gaustadlicious for four more years. Contract valued at $9.2 milllion.
- Andreas Lilja got a two year contract extension. TSN reports that it's for a bit more than the $1 million he made last year.
- The Panthers aren't letting the Lightning steal all the thunder in Florida these days. They inked Rostislav Olesz for six years at about $18.75. Panthers hockey ... Feel the excitement! But seriously he is a pretty good young player.
- Jody Shelley will be a Shark for two more years. I cannot think of a witty comment. Create your own!
- Ryan Malone, Gary Roberts and Vaclav Prospal signed on with the Tampa Bay Lightning. Have you heard about it? It hasn't really been covered that much.
- John-Michael Liles and Adam Foote both re-upped with the Avalanche only a day before they were to hit the open market. Liles' deal is estimated to be four years and a bit over $4 million per. Foote is rumored to have gotten two years at $3 million per. I'm still looking for someone to pay me half that.
- The Flyers signed Steve Eminger to a one-year deal.
